Importance of Medical Evacuation Coverage for Senior Travel Insurance
Medical evacuation coverage is a crucial component of senior travel insurance as it provides seniors with the necessary support and resources in case of a medical emergency while traveling. This coverage ensures that seniors can receive timely and efficient medical care, including transportation to a medical facility or back home if needed.
Examples of Situations Where Medical Evacuation Coverage is Vital
- In the event of a serious illness or injury that requires specialized medical treatment not available at the travel destination, medical evacuation coverage can arrange for transportation to a facility where seniors can receive appropriate care.
- If a senior experiences a medical emergency in a remote location with limited medical facilities, medical evacuation coverage can facilitate their safe transfer to a hospital with better resources.
Risks Seniors Face Without Medical Evacuation Coverage
- Seniors traveling without medical evacuation coverage may face exorbitant costs for emergency medical transportation, which can lead to financial strain and potential inability to access necessary medical care.
- Inadequate medical facilities or lack of appropriate care at the travel destination can jeopardize seniors’ health and well-being, especially in critical situations where timely medical evacuation is essential.
Coverage Details and Benefits
Medical evacuation coverage for senior travel insurance includes the following specific coverage details and benefits:
Specific Coverage Details
- Coverage for emergency medical transportation to the nearest appropriate medical facility
- Assistance in coordinating and arranging medical evacuation services
- Coverage for medical repatriation to return seniors home after receiving medical treatment
- 24/7 access to a team of professionals to help with medical emergencies
Benefits of Medical Evacuation Coverage
- Rapid response and evacuation in the event of a medical emergency, ensuring seniors receive timely and appropriate care
- Financial protection from high costs associated with medical evacuation services, which can amount to tens of thousands of dollars
- Piece of mind for seniors and their families knowing that they have access to necessary medical services in case of an emergency
Financial Protection Example
In a scenario where a senior traveler suffers a serious medical emergency while abroad and requires immediate evacuation to a medical facility, the costs of medical transportation via air ambulance can easily exceed $50,000. With medical evacuation coverage, the insurance provider will cover these expenses, relieving the senior and their family from the financial burden.
Factors to Consider When Choosing a Plan
When selecting a medical evacuation coverage plan as a senior traveler, there are key factors that you should take into consideration to ensure you get the most suitable and effective coverage for your needs.
Insurance Provider Comparison
- Research different insurance providers offering medical evacuation coverage for seniors.
- Compare the reputation, customer reviews, and financial stability of each insurance provider.
- Look into the network of hospitals and evacuation services they work with to ensure global coverage.
Coverage Options Checklist
- Check if the plan covers emergency medical evacuation to the nearest suitable medical facility.
- Ensure the coverage includes transportation to a hospital of your choice if needed.
- Verify if the plan covers the cost of a medical escort if necessary.
- Consider the maximum coverage limit for medical evacuation expenses.
- Look for additional benefits such as repatriation of remains in case of unfortunate events.
